The core of this offer is access to the YouTube TV Base Plan, a robust package delivering a familiar television landscape. Viewers gain access to local network affiliates alongside popular channels like ESPN, AMC, CNN, and TNT – a total exceeding 140 channels.
Beyond live viewing, the Base Plan provides a powerful feature: unlimited DVR storage. This allows for recording and revisiting programs at leisure, complemented by the option to enhance the experience with premium add-ons like HBO Max, Paramount+, and Starz.
While this current bundle presents a compelling value, the future of YouTube TV promises even greater flexibility. The platform is preparing to launch a series of specialized, genre-focused bundles later in the year.
These forthcoming bundles, numbering over ten, aim to cater to specific interests at a significantly lower cost than the standard plan. A sports-centric bundle, for example, will consolidate ESPN Unlimited, FS1, and NBC Sports Network into a focused offering.
Details regarding pricing and exact channel lineups for these specialized bundles remain forthcoming. However, the expectation is that they will provide a dramatically more affordable entry point to the YouTube TV ecosystem.
